FAYETTEVILLE, N.C. — A man has been arrested in connection with a shooting death in Fayetteville last month.

Officers responding to a reported shooting in the 6300 block of Raeford Road on Sept. 24, 2018, found a crashed vehicle near the intersection of Bingham Drive and McDougal Drive.

The driver, Justin L. Williams, 42, had been shot and died at the scene.

A 14-month-old inside the vehicle was taken to Cape Fear Valley Medical Center and was listed in good condition, police said.

On Friday, Lavaris Davarian Speight, 20, of the 2500 block of Brandon Circle in Wilson, turned himself in to authorities. Sepight is charged with first-degree murder, two counts of second-degree kidnapping, two counts of shooting into an occupied vehicle and assault in the presence of a minor.

Speight was being held at the Wilson County Jail and was awaiting transfer to the Cumberland County Detention Center.
